My 02 Trailblazer LS lost low beams last week, right after jump starting a guy with my car running. High beams are good. I checked underhood low beam fuses 3+6, swapped relays 45+46 (even tried a new one) and checked all the fuses in driver side 2nd row underseat fuse block: 4, 7, 32, 40, 50, 52. All are good and low beams are still out.
Anything else to try other than thinking that both low beam bulbs somehow burned out simultaneously? Thanks... :undecided
